Market Snapshot: Pharmaceutical Membrane Filtration Market Growth and Opportunity
The global pharmaceutical membrane filtration market grew from USD 10.18 billion in 2024 to USD 11.60 billion by 2025, advancing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 13.73% with an expected valuation of USD 28.51 billion by 2032. Robust market expansion is underpinned by the convergence of evolving regulatory requirements, increased complexity in biologics, and the trend toward personalized medicines. The Americas, Europe, Middle East & Africa, and Asia-Pacific each demonstrate distinct patterns of adoption and investment, creating a landscape rich in opportunity for forward-thinking organizations.
Scope & Segmentation: Defining Market Structure and Innovation
- Filtration Technology: Microfiltration, Nanofiltration, Reverse Osmosis, Ultrafiltration
- Membrane Material: Ceramic (Alumina, Silicon Carbide, Titania, Zirconia), Polymeric (Cellulose Acetate, Polyethersulfone, Polytetrafluoroethylene, Polyvinylidene Fluoride)
- Module Configuration: Hollow Fiber, Plate And Frame, Spiral Wound, Tubular
- Application: Active Pharmaceutical Ingredient Production, Bioprocessing (Downstream Processing, Fermentation Broth Separation), Formulation, Water Treatment
- End User: Contract Manufacturing Organizations, Pharmaceutical Companies, Research Institutes

Key Takeaways: Strategic Insights for Market Stakeholders
- Advanced membrane filtration enables critical separation and purity standards essential for both drug formulation and water systems in the pharmaceutical sector.
- Adoption trends focus on achieving operational resilience and driving down downtime and waste, ensuring a leaner and more agile pharmaceutical value chain.
- Technological advancements, including the integration of digital controls and predictive maintenance, are positioning filtration systems as integral components of continuous and scale-appropriate manufacturing models.
- Material selection shapes process outcomes, with ceramics delivering durability in aggressive applications and polymers offering flexibility and manufacturability for a variety of operations.
- Emerging regions are rapidly investing in both standard and custom filtration systems, driven by rising demand for local active ingredient production and biopharmaceutical expansion.
- Collaborative approaches, such as cross-sector partnerships between material scientists and equipment manufacturers, foster innovation and streamline new technology deployment.
